Output faf8fca8a7b25bb6dfe595bdcb249d0362b7b03d5816caccedc75d6469ead76a:0

value
3061726
script pubkey
OP_0 OP_PUSHBYTES_20 6857c153c9978b052ff252864bc1bd6f0eb4600e
address
bc1qdptuz57fj79s2tlj22ryhsdadu8tgcqwg5d6l9
transaction
faf8fca8a7b25bb6dfe595bdcb249d0362b7b03d5816caccedc75d6469ead76a
confirmations
109481
spent
true